Joan E. Majewski

August 13, 2024 at 9:31 p.m.


Joan E. Majewski, 79, of Warsaw, passed away on Monday, Aug. 12, 2024, at  Lutheran Hospital of Fort Wayne.
Joan was born on Dec. 8, 1944, in Chicago, to Andrew “Anthony” and Petronella Antoniak Majewski.
She was a graduate of St. Procopius and continued on to cosmetology school at Vogue Beauty in Chicago.
She worked in accounting for RR Donnelly & Sons for 30 years. Joan was a member of Sacred Heart Catholic Church.
Joan will be lovingly remembered by niece, Donna Majewski; and nephew, David Majewski.
She was preceded in passing by both parents; brothers, Tony Majewski, Joseph Majewski; and sister-in-law, Patricia Majewski.
A Mass of Christian burial will be held at 11 a.m. on Friday, Aug. 16 at Sacred Heart Catholic Church, Warsaw. Visitation will be from 10 to 11 a.m. on Friday, Aug. 16 at Sacred Heart with Father David officiating.
Interment will follow in Oakwood Cemetery, Warsaw.
